This has been happening for a few months now, and it's driving me bonkers.

If I leave my HTPC alone for a period of time like say, an hour or more, than come back and start a video with XBMC, The video plays at a 1-4fps and I have no audio at all. This also happened on 12.0 and 12.1 XBMC versions.The only thing that fixes it is a complete P reboot. This happens whether or not my PC has gone to sleep.

Other video players such as MPC-HC and VLC also will not play audio, though picture is fine. And this only happens if XBMC has been launched after boot. If I don't launch XBMC at alll, the other players run all day just fine.

XBMC Log: http://pastebin.com/5ij8E0hc


I've been trying to finger this bastard out before begging for help, but here I am. Any help would be lovely.

Specs:
XBMC 12.2
Win 7 x64
HD 6670 1gb (also used for audio) with 13.5 6 beta 2 drivers.
4gb DDR2
Q9550 3.4ghz
